Tippi Hedren

Tippi Hedren (born Nathalie Kay Hedren, January 19, 1930) is an American actress, former fashion model and an animal rights activist. She made her film debut in ''The Birds'' in 1963, followed by the title role in ''Marnie'' in 1964. In her later years, she has been involved with animal rescue at Shambala Preserve, an wildlife habitat which she founded in 1983. Hedren was also instrumental in the development of Vietnamese-American nail salons in the United States.〔
==Early life==
For much of her career, Hedren's year of birth was misreported as 1935.〔(【引用サイトリンク】title=Biodata )〕〔(Tippi Hedren biography ), msn.com; retrieved October 20, 2012.〕〔(Tippi Hedren profile ), filmreference.com; retrieved October 20, 2012.〕〔(Tippi Hedren profile ), nytimes.com; retrieved January 22, 2014.〕〔(Tippi Hedren films ), blockbuster.com; retrieved January 22, 2014.〕 In 2004, however, she acknowledged that she was actually born on January 19, 1930〔 (which is confirmed by her birth registration information at the Minnesota Historical Society) in New Ulm, Minnesota, to Bernard Carl and Dorothea Henrietta (née Eckhardt) Hedren.〔 Her paternal grandparents were immigrants from Sweden, while her maternal ancestry is German and Norwegian. Her father ran a small general store in the small town of Lafayette, Minnesota, and gave her the nickname "Tippi". When she was four, she moved with her parents to Minneapolis.
As a teenager, Hedren took part in department store fashion shows. Her parents relocated to California while she was a high school student. On reaching her 20th birthday, she bought a ticket to New York City and began a professional modeling career. Within the year she made her unofficial film debut as an uncredited extra in the musical comedy ''The Petty Girl''. In interviews she refers to ''The Birds'' as her first film.〔Vroman, Lavender. ''Tippi Hedren airs out her early acting days, wildlife preservation'', ''Antelope Valley Press'', p. A6, September 30, 2004.〕
